GDP Deflator in Saudi Arabia increased to 119.50 points in 2021 from 103.72 points in 2020. GDP Deflator in Saudi Arabia averaged 57.39 points from 1970 until 2021, reaching an all time high of 120.17 points in 2012 and a record low of 5.00 points in 1970. source: General Authority for Statistics, Saudi Arabia

GDP Deflator in Saudi Arabia is expected to reach 121.65 points by the end of 2026, according to Trading Economics global macro models and analysts expectations. In the long-term, the Saudi Arabia GDP Deflator is projected to trend around 123.96 points in 2027 and 126.44 points in 2028, according to our econometric models.
